League of Legends: Wild Rift will be released as a mobile game in 2020

Developer studio Riot Games announced on Tuesday a mobile version of League of Legends: Wild Rift for 2020.

The now ten-year-old game is set to be released for mobile devices next year. However, this will not be a simple port but rather a "complete reinterpretation" - according to producer Michael Chow. The title was therefore developed specifically for mobile gaming.

“To get the gameplay just right, we had to rebuild it from scratch,” said Chow. "We have spent a long time making sure that this is a true League of Legends experience that is worth investing your precious playing time in." - said the producer. The new League of Legends: Wild Rift offers the same five-on-five gameplay as its PC counterpart. However, the fight time is reduced to 15 - 20 minutes. The controls will use a dual stick to enable quick access to movement, throws and more. The "Teamfight Tactics" mode will also be integrated.

The first rumors about a mobile version of League of Legends appeared in May of this year. The title is a computer game for Windows and macOS developed by Riot Games. The game was released on October 27, 2009. It is a free-to-play MOBA that is financed through microtransactions. The game was played by around 100 million players per month in 2016.
